Autofs Mount Process

What the autofs service does when a mount request is triggered depends on how the automounter maps are configured. The mount process is generally the same for all mounts, but the final result changes with the mount point specified and the complexity of the maps. The mount process has also been changed with the Solaris 2.6 release, to include the creation of the trigger nodes.

A Simple Autofs Mount

To help explain the autofs mount process, assume that the following files are installed.


$ cat /etc/auto_master
# Master map for automounter
#
+auto_master
/net        -hosts        -nosuid,nobrowse
/home       auto_home     -nobrowse
/xfn        -xfn
/share      auto_share
$ cat /etc/auto_share
# share directory map for automounter
#
ws          gumbo:/export/share/ws

When the /share directory is accessed the autofs service creates a trigger node for /share/ws which can be seen in /etc/mnttab as an entry which resembles the following entry:


-hosts  /share/ws     autofs  nosuid,nobrowse,ignore,nest,dev=###

When the /share/ws directory is accessed the autofs service completes the process with these steps:

  1. pings the server's mount service to see if it's alive.

  2. mounts the requested file system under /share. Now /etc/mnttab file contains the following entries:


    -hosts  /share/ws     autofs  nosuid,nobrowse,ignore,nest,dev=###
    gumbo:/export/share/ws /share/ws   nfs   nosuid,dev=####    #####

Hierarchical Mounting

When multiple layers are defined in the automounter files, the mount process becomes more complex. If the /etc/auto_shared file from the previous example is expanded to contain:


# share directory map for automounter
#
ws       /       gumbo:/export/share/ws
         /usr    gumbo:/export/share/ws/usr

The mount process is basically the same as the previous example when the /share/ws mount point is accessed. In addition, a trigger node to the next level (/usr) is created in the /share/ws file system so that the next level can be easily mounted if it is accessed.


Note -

In this example, /export/share/ws/usr must exist on the NFS server for the trigger node to be created.


Autofs Unmounting

The unmounting that occurs after a certain amount of idle time is from the bottom up (reverse order of mounting). If one of the directories at a higher level in the hierarchy is busy, only file systems below that directory are unmounted.
